Facultad de Ingeniería Civil y Mecánica, Carrera de Ingeniería Mecánica, 2024-02) Tenorio Cabezas, Vanessa Estefanía; Paredes Salinas, Juan GilbertoActually the application of composite materials for the forming and creation of components or accessories is one of the greatest needs in the industrial field, aiming to reduce the weight and the replacement of metals, preserving or improving the properties of the materials. The progress of the forming processes are mostly manual, causing irreversible failures such as porosity, cracks, air bubbles and more defects, forming less resistant laminates. The Technical Project focused on obtaining the main parameters involved in the vacuum infusion process applied to a laminate with a complex shape, that is, curved, inclined, straight and deep areas. In addition, Tensile-Flexural tests were carried out to check the mechanical properties of the laminate obtained and cured at a temperature of 80 grades Celsius for two hours. The results obtained through the application of the process were compared with other commercial projects that were formed under the same parameters. The technical work showed that for a vacuum infusion process, permeability is one of the parameters that influenced at the time of lamination, using and applying Darcy's Law, for that reason it was important to select the complements (vacuum infusion kit) and it was verified that the orientations of the natural or synthetic fibers should be at 45 grades for greater resistance, but if a laminate with lower residence is desired, the recommended orientation is from 0 to 90 grades.
